Chemical & Physical Properties
[ Density]:
1.4±0.1 g/cm3
[ Boiling Point ]:
141.1±0.0 °C at 760 mmHg
[ Molecular Formula ]:
C8H3F5
[ Molecular Weight ]:
194.101
[ Flash Point ]:
34.4±0.0 °C
[ Exact Mass ]:
194.015488
[ LogP ]:
2.99
[ Vapour Pressure ]:
7.4±0.2 mmHg at 25°C
[ Index of Refraction ]:
1.457
[ Storage condition ]:
−20°C
[ Stability ]:
Flammable. Incompatible with strong oxidizing agents.
